Part of any good preparation for buying and then reselling items from an e-commerce platform is research, research, research. You really need to do your homework before you dive in. In my past post, I addressed some tips of how to get started (the positive), but it’s also important to know about the bad guys (the negative). In addition to providing access to the Alibaba Fair Play Fund if you are defrauded, Alibaba.com provides an explanation of their blacklisting policy on their Web site.
